| Obverse description | A detailed cityscape of Wernigerode in high relief depicting the historic town hall with its characteristic spires and surrounding half-timbered buildings lining a street. A stylised rising sun with radiating lines fills the upper field. The legend arcs across the upper and lower rim. |

| Reverse description | The reverse is divided into two registers framed by a ring of twelve stars. The upper register depicts three European landmarks in relief: a Dutch windmill to the left, the Eiffel Tower in the centre, and a Ferris wheel to the right. A central band bears the brand legend. The lower register shows three further landmarks: the Atomium of Brussels to the left, a Gothic cathedral facade in the centre, and a topographic map outline to the right. The legend arcs along the upper and lower rim. |
